The 2018 Jaguar E-Pace is a small SUV. When it was new, prices in Australia typically ranged from $47,750 for the base variant and topping out at $84,370 for the First Edition variant.
There are 9 variants of the E-Pace available in Australia and this generation went on sale in late-2017.
The 2018 E-Pace was offered with a 3 year, 100,000 km warranty.
Engine options for the Jaguar E-Pace include 2.0 in-line 4-cylinder turbo (110kW/380Nm), 2.0 in-line 4-cylinder turbo (183kW/365Nm), 2.0 in-line 4-cylinder turbo (132kW/430Nm), 2.0 in-line 4-cylinder turbo (221kW/400Nm) and 2.0 in-line 4-cylinder turbo (177kW/500Nm). All variants feature 9-speed automatic with manual mode transmission. All variants feature 4x4.

The cheapest Jaguar E-Pace is the base variant that starts from $47,750.
See all Jaguar E-Pace PricingThe most expensive Jaguar E-Pace is the First Edition variant that starts from $84,370.
See all Jaguar E-Pace PricingThe best towing capacity of a Jaguar E-Pace is 1800 kg shared by all variants.
See all Jaguar E-Pace towing capacityThe largest Jaguar E-Pace is the base variant which measures 1900mm wide, 4411mm in length and sits 1649mm tall.
The most powerful variants with 221kW of power and 400nm of torque are the S, R-Dynamic S, SE, R-Dynamic Se, HSE and R-Dynamic Hse variants.
The Jaguar E-Pace is manufactured in different countries, depending on the variant, then shipped to Australia. The Jaguar E-Pace may be manufactured in Austria or Great Britain.
The heaviest Jaguar E-Pace is the S variant which has a gross vehicle weight of 2420 kg.
The Jaguar E-Pace may use different fuel/energy types based on the variant which includes Premium Unleaded or Diesel.
